Transaction 68834195b24eae560e54d048e506a545852b7ac2e969fc7c86ec756b4c37153f
1 Input
1 Output
-
68834195b24eae560e54d048e506a545852b7ac2e969fc7c86ec756b4c37153f:0
- value
- 9602421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c6e0fb4d42788ddef73d57da2744284addf3fa3 OP_EQUAL
- address
- 3D2wZXZ5njLML9GeBvfnjTQsCojPQrPT9P